/* ************ DOCUMENTATION IN ORIGINAL FILE *********************/
// This is the ``Mersenne Twister'' random number generator MT19937, which
// generates pseudorandom integers uniformly distributed in 0..(2^32 - 1)
// starting from any odd seed in 0..(2^32 - 1). This version is a recode
// by Shawn Cokus (Cokus@math.washington.edu) on March 8, 1998 of a version by
// Takuji Nishimura (who had suggestions from Topher Cooper and Marc Rieffel in
// July-August 1997).
//
// Effectiveness of the recoding (on Goedel2.math.washington.edu, a DEC Alpha
// running OSF/1) using GCC -O3 as a compiler: before recoding: 51.6 sec. to
// generate 300 million random numbers; after recoding: 24.0 sec. for the same
// (i.e., 46.5% of original time), so speed is now about 12.5 million random
// number generations per second on this machine.
//
// According to the URL <http://www.math.keio.ac.jp/~matumoto/emt.html>
// (and paraphrasing a bit in places), the Mersenne Twister is ``designed
// with consideration of the flaws of various existing generators,'' has
// a period of 2^19937 - 1, gives a sequence that is 623-dimensionally
// equidistributed, and ``has passed many stringent tests, including the
// die-hard test of G. Marsaglia and the load test of P. Hellekalek and
// S. Wegenkittl.'' It is efficient in memory usage (typically using 2506
// to 5012 bytes of static data, depending on data type sizes, and the code
// is quite short as well). It generates random numbers in batches of 624
// at a time, so the caching and pipelining of modern systems is exploited.
// It is also divide- and mod-free.

//
// We initialize state[0..(N-1)] via the generator
//
// x_new = (69069 * x_old) mod 2^32
//
// from Line 15 of Table 1, p. 106, Sec. 3.3.4 of Knuth's
// _The Art of Computer Programming_, Volume 2, 3rd ed.
//
// Notes (SJC): I do not know what the initial state requirements
// of the Mersenne Twister are, but it seems this seeding generator
// could be better. It achieves the maximum period for its modulus
// (2^30) iff x_initial is odd (p. 20-21, Sec. 3.2.1.2, Knuth); if
// x_initial can be even, you have sequences like 0, 0, 0, ...;
// 2^31, 2^31, 2^31, ...; 2^30, 2^30, 2^30, ...; 2^29, 2^29 + 2^31,
// 2^29, 2^29 + 2^31, ..., etc. so I force seed to be odd below.
//
// Even if x_initial is odd, if x_initial is 1 mod 4 then
//
// the lowest bit of x is always 1,
// the next-to-lowest bit of x is always 0,
// the 2nd-from-lowest bit of x alternates ... 0 1 0 1 0 1 0 1 ... ,
// the 3rd-from-lowest bit of x 4-cycles ... 0 1 1 0 0 1 1 0 ... ,
// the 4th-from-lowest bit of x has the 8-cycle ... 0 0 0 1 1 1 1 0 ... ,
// ...
//
// and if x_initial is 3 mod 4 then
//
// the lowest bit of x is always 1,
// the next-to-lowest bit of x is always 1,
// the 2nd-from-lowest bit of x alternates ... 0 1 0 1 0 1 0 1 ... ,
// the 3rd-from-lowest bit of x 4-cycles ... 0 0 1 1 0 0 1 1 ... ,
// the 4th-from-lowest bit of x has the 8-cycle ... 0 0 1 1 1 1 0 0 ... ,
// ...
//
// The generator's potency (min. s>=0 with (69069-1)^s = 0 mod 2^32) is
// 16, which seems to be alright by p. 25, Sec. 3.2.1.3 of Knuth. It
// also does well in the dimension 2..5 spectral tests, but it could be
// better in dimension 6 (Line 15, Table 1, p. 106, Sec. 3.3.4, Knuth).
//
// Note that the random number user does not see the values generated
// here directly since restart() will always munge them first, so maybe
// none of all of this matters. In fact, the seed values made here could
// even be extra-special desirable if the Mersenne Twister theory says
// so-- that's why the only change I made is to restrict to odd seeds.
//
